Scalise underwent another surgery on Saturday and "continues to show signs of improvement", MedStar Washington Hospital Center said in a statement.
Scalise was one of several people shot by suspect James T. Hodgkinson ― a 66-year-old resident of IL ― who targeted a GOP team baseball practice in Alexandria, Virginia, on Wednesday.
The shooter, James T. Hodgkinson, was killed by police Wednesday after firing dozens of bullets during the congressional practice session.
Scalise, the number three Republican in the House of Representatives, arrived at the hospital in a critical state, facing "an imminent risk of death", according to Sava.

The bullet that struck Scalise "travelled across his pelvis, fracturing bones, injuring internal organs, and causing severe bleeding", his doctors said. He added that Scalise would be in the hospital "for some time" and would need "a period of healing and rehabilitation" after being discharged. He remains in critical condition.
The Scalise family also said they greatly appreciate the outpouring of thoughts and prayers for the wounded congressman.
"I think that an excellent recovery is a good possibility", Dr. Jack Sava, director of trauma at MedStar Washington Hospital Center said at a news conference Friday afternoon.
